1

現在、Web サイトを IIS6 から IIS7.5 に移行しています。データベースに接続し、ANSI 範囲外の文字 (ゲール文字) を含むデータを取得してページに表示する ANSI (Notepad++ による) でエンコードされた従来の ASP ファイルがあります。その後、ブラウザでページを表示すると、ゲール語の文字が疑問符として表示されます。ASP ファイルのエンコーディングを UTF-8 に変更すると、ゲール文字が正常に表示されます。

問題は、UTF-8 に変換する必要がある何万もの ASP ページがあることです。現時点では、変換を適用するオプションはありません。

  1. ASP ファイルを UTF-8 として読み取るように Web サーバー (IIS7.5) を構成する方法はありますか?
  2. すべてのページを UTF-8 に変換する代替ソリューションはありますか?

これらのページは、何らかの理由で IIS6 で正常に動作します。

4

2 に答える 2

2

私はちょうど答えに出くわしました。

  1. IIS マネージャーを開く
  2. サーバーまたは Web サイト ノードのいずれかを選択します
  3. 機能ビューにいることを確認してください
  4. ASP設定を開く
  5. という設定があるはずCode Pageです。これを値に設定します65001
  6. Apply右側のアクション ペインをクリックします。
于 2012-11-06T16:04:10.523 に答える